The combination of ado-trastuzumab emtansine (T-DM1) and imatinib represents a case where two medications are used concomitantly, with potential drug interactions. According to the search results, imatinib can interact with ado-trastuzumab emtansine by increasing T-DM1 concentrations, potentially leading to T-DM1-related toxicity[1][3]. ## Drug Information **Ado-trastuzumab emtansine (T-DM1)** is an antibody-drug conjugate that combines the HER2-targeted monoclonal antibody trastuzumab with the cytotoxic agent DM1 (a maytansine derivative)[2][7]. It's marketed under the brand name Kadcyla and is primarily used for treating HER2-positive metastatic breast cancer in patients who previously received trastuzumab and a taxane[5][6]. **Imatinib** is a tyrosine kinase inhibitor that acts as a CYP3A4 inhibitor. It's commonly used in treating chronic myeloid leukemia (CML) and other cancers[1]. ## Interaction Mechanism The interaction between these drugs occurs because: - Imatinib is a CYP3A4 inhibitor - Ado-trastuzumab emtansine (T-DM1) is a CYP3A4 substrate - This interaction can increase T-DM1 concentrations, potentially leading to increased toxicity[1][3] ## Clinical Evidence There is limited published evidence on the concomitant use of these medications. The search results mention a case report of a 37-year-old female with both chronic myeloid leukemia (treated with imatinib) and metastatic HER2-positive breast cancer who received T-DM1 while continuing imatinib therapy[1]. In this case: - The patient had developed lung metastasis after previous treatment with trastuzumab and vinorelbine - T-DM1 and imatinib were administered concomitantly - No significant side effects were observed except for grade 1 fatigue - This case report was noted as the first to document the concomitant use of these medications[1] ## Safety Considerations When considering this combination, healthcare providers should be aware of: - The potential for increased T-DM1 concentrations due to the metabolic interaction - Possible increased risk of T-DM1-related toxicities - The need for careful monitoring when these medications are used together While the single case report suggested tolerability, more research would be needed to establish the safety profile of this combination across a broader patient population.
